About the role
The Vanderbilt Psychiatric Mental Health Nurse Practitioner (PMHNP) Fellowship is a 12-month postgraduate program focusing on child and adolescent psychiatry. Fellows will gain exposure to various services including outpatient, inpatient, consult-liaison, and state custody consulting, alongside structured didactics.
